IntelliJ IDEA開(kāi)發(fā)Maven時(shí)工具欄消失的三種恢復(fù)方法
一、問(wèn)題現(xiàn)象與背景
在使用 IntelliJ IDEA(簡(jiǎn)稱 IDEA)開(kāi)發(fā) Maven 項(xiàng)目時(shí),偶爾會(huì)遇到右側(cè)或側(cè)邊欄的 Maven 工具欄(顯示依賴、生命周期等信息的窗口)突然消失的情況。這可能影響開(kāi)發(fā)者快速操作 Maven 構(gòu)建、依賴管理等功能,甚至導(dǎo)致項(xiàng)目配置混亂。
二、快速恢復(fù) Maven 工具欄的 3 種方法
1. 快速調(diào)出 Maven 窗口(推薦)
適用場(chǎng)景:工具欄被意外關(guān)閉,但項(xiàng)目本身仍為 Maven 項(xiàng)目。
操作步驟:
- 通過(guò)菜單欄:
- 點(diǎn)擊頂部菜單欄的
View
。 - 選擇
Tool Windows
→Maven
(或直接按快捷鍵Alt + 5
)。
- 點(diǎn)擊頂部菜單欄的
- 通過(guò)搜索功能:
- 按下
Ctrl + Shift + A
(Windows/Linux)或Cmd + Shift + A
(Mac)。 - 輸入
Maven
,選擇Maven
選項(xiàng)即可顯示。
- 按下
小技巧:
- 若窗口仍不顯示,可能是 IDEA 的布局被意外修改,可嘗試
Window
→Restore Default Layout
重置界面布局。
2. 確保項(xiàng)目被識(shí)別為 Maven 項(xiàng)目
適用場(chǎng)景:IDEA 未正確識(shí)別項(xiàng)目類型,導(dǎo)致 Maven 工具欄未初始化。
操作步驟:
- 手動(dòng)添加 Maven 項(xiàng)目:
- 右鍵點(diǎn)擊項(xiàng)目根目錄下的 pom.xml 文件。
- 選擇 Add as Maven Project(或 + Add Maven Projects)。
- 重新導(dǎo)入 Maven 項(xiàng)目:
- 打開(kāi) Maven 窗口(即使不可見(jiàn),此操作會(huì)強(qiáng)制刷新)。
- 點(diǎn)擊窗口頂部的 + 圖標(biāo),選擇 Add Maven Projects。
3. 檢查項(xiàng)目配置文件(.idea 文件夾)
適用場(chǎng)景:項(xiàng)目配置文件損壞或未生成,導(dǎo)致 IDEA 無(wú)法加載 Maven 配置。
操作步驟:
- 刪除并重建
.idea
文件夾:- 關(guān)閉當(dāng)前項(xiàng)目。
- 在文件系統(tǒng)中刪除項(xiàng)目根目錄下的隱藏文件夾
.idea
。 - 重新用 IDEA 打開(kāi)項(xiàng)目,系統(tǒng)會(huì)自動(dòng)生成新的配置文件。
三、深度排查
1. 清理 IDEA 緩存
適用場(chǎng)景:IDEA 緩存異常導(dǎo)致項(xiàng)目類型識(shí)別失敗。
操作步驟:
- 進(jìn)入
File
→Invalidate Caches / Restart
。 - 選擇
Invalidate and Restart
,等待 IDEA 重啟并重新加載項(xiàng)目。
2. 檢查 Maven 配置路徑
適用場(chǎng)景:IDEA 的 Maven 配置路徑錯(cuò)誤或未指向正確版本。
操作步驟:
- 打開(kāi) File → Settings(Windows/Linux)或 IntelliJ IDEA → Preferences(Mac)。
- 定位到 Build, Execution, Deployment → Build Tools → Maven。
- 確保以下配置正確:
- Maven home path:指向本地 Maven 安裝目錄(如 E:/develop/Maven)。
- User settings file:指向 settings.xml 文件(默認(rèn)通常位于 ~/.m2/)。
3. 驗(yàn)證項(xiàng)目是否為 Maven 項(xiàng)目
適用場(chǎng)景:項(xiàng)目缺少 pom.xml
或文件未被正確識(shí)別。
操作步驟:
- 檢查
pom.xml
存在性:- 在項(xiàng)目根目錄下確認(rèn)
pom.xml
文件存在。
- 在項(xiàng)目根目錄下確認(rèn)
- 修復(fù)文件關(guān)聯(lián):
- 右鍵點(diǎn)擊
pom.xml
→ 取消勾選Mark as Plain Text
(若被誤標(biāo)記為普通文本)。
- 右鍵點(diǎn)擊
4. 檢查 Maven 插件狀態(tài)
適用場(chǎng)景:IDEA 的 Maven 插件未啟用或損壞。
操作步驟:
- 進(jìn)入
File
→Settings
→Plugins
。 - 搜索
Maven Integration
,確保插件已啟用。 - 若未安裝,通過(guò)
Marketplace
搜索并安裝。
四、通用解決方案:第三方插件工具欄消失問(wèn)題
若其他插件(如 Docker、Spring Boot 等)的工具欄也消失,可參考以下通用方法:
- 通過(guò)菜單欄恢復(fù):
- 點(diǎn)擊 View → Tool Windows,選擇對(duì)應(yīng)插件名稱。
- 重置布局:
- 若界面混亂,嘗試 Window → Restore Default Layout。
五、常見(jiàn)問(wèn)題
Q:重啟后問(wèn)題又出現(xiàn),怎么辦?
A:檢查項(xiàng)目根目錄的 .idea
文件夾是否被意外刪除或損壞,重新生成配置后重啟。
Q:執(zhí)行 Add Maven Projects 無(wú)反應(yīng)?
A:可能是 Maven 配置路徑錯(cuò)誤,需手動(dòng)指定 Maven 安裝目錄(如 mvn -v
查看本地 Maven 版本)。
Q:如何徹底清除 IDEA 緩存?
A:手動(dòng)刪除 C:\Users\<用戶名>\.IntelliJIdea<版本>\system
(Windows)或 ~/Library/Caches/IntelliJIdea<版本>
(Mac)目錄。
附:操作示意圖
菜單欄路徑:View → Tool Windows → Maven
快捷鍵組合:Ctrl + Shift + A
→ 輸入 Maven
→ 選擇工具窗口
插件管理界面:Settings → Plugins → 搜索 Maven Integration
以上就是IntelliJ IDEA開(kāi)發(fā)Maven時(shí)工具欄消失的三種恢復(fù)方法的詳細(xì)內(nèi)容,更多關(guān)于IDEA Maven工具欄消失的資料請(qǐng)關(guān)注腳本之家其它相關(guān)文章!
相關(guān)文章
SpringShell命令行之交互式Shell應(yīng)用開(kāi)發(fā)方式
本文將深入探討Spring Shell的核心特性、實(shí)現(xiàn)方式及應(yīng)用場(chǎng)景,幫助開(kāi)發(fā)者掌握這一強(qiáng)大工具,具有很好的參考價(jià)值,希望對(duì)大家有所幫助,如有錯(cuò)誤或未考慮完全的地方,望不吝賜教2025-04-04Java使用Filter實(shí)現(xiàn)登錄驗(yàn)證
本文主要介紹了Java使用Filter實(shí)現(xiàn)登錄驗(yàn)證,Filter類似于門(mén)衛(wèi),你在進(jìn)入之前門(mén)衛(wèi)需要盤(pán)查你,身份合法進(jìn)入,身份不合法攔截,感興趣的可以了解一下2023-11-11SpringBoot導(dǎo)出Excel的四種實(shí)現(xiàn)方式
近期接到了一個(gè)小需求,要將系統(tǒng)中的數(shù)據(jù)導(dǎo)出為Excel,且能將Excel數(shù)據(jù)導(dǎo)入到系統(tǒng),對(duì)于大多數(shù)研發(fā)人員來(lái)說(shuō),這算是一個(gè)最基本的操作了,本文就給大家總結(jié)一下SpringBoot導(dǎo)出Excel的四種實(shí)現(xiàn)方式,需要的朋友可以參考下2024-01-01MybatisPlus使用排序查詢時(shí)將null值放到最后
按照更新時(shí)間排序,但是更新時(shí)間可能為null,因此將null的數(shù)據(jù)放到最后,本文主要介紹了MybatisPlus使用排序查詢時(shí)將null值放到最后,具有一定的參考價(jià)值,感興趣的可以了解一下2023-08-08